4.5 Print off the feedback sheets before the lesson starts.  It may be a good idea to move your students into a different seating order so that they get to see presentations they have never seen before.  The students write their name at the top of the sheet and then leave it next to their computer and have their presentation ready on the first slide.  Each student fills in 3 sheets.  When they return to their seats they read through the scores and write down what are their priorities to refine their work next lesson.  You may wish to discuss what makes a good score.  Maximum score 30.
